President Recep Tayyip Erdoğan spoke by phone with President Vladimir Putin of Russia

President Recep Tayyip Erdoğan spoke by phone with President Vladimir Putin of Russia. The call addressed the Israel-Iran conflict, bilateral relations, and regional issues. President Erdoğan stated that the spiral of violence triggered by Israel’s attacks on Iran is putting the security of the entire region at risk, that the Netanyahu government’s lawless stance poses a clear threat to the international system, and that the region cannot withstand another war. President Erdoğan, President Pezeshkian of Iran talk over phone

President Recep Tayyip Erdoğan spoke by phone with President Masoud Pezeshkian of Iran. The call addressed the conflict between Israel and Iran, as well as regional and global matters. During the call, President Erdoğan stated that he has held a series of contacts with various leaders regarding the ongoing conflict between Israel and Iran, and that Türkiye is ready to assume a facilitating role to ensure the swift end of the clashes and a return to nuclear negotiations. President Erdoğan underlined Türkiye’s strong commitment to preserving peace and stability in its region.

President Erdoğan, US President Trump talk over phone

President Recep Tayyip Erdoğan spoke by phone with President Donald J. Trump of the United States of America today. The call addressed bilateral and regional issues, particularly the conflict between Israel and Iran. Welcoming the recent statements made by President Trump regarding the cessation of clashes between Israel and Iran and the establishment of peace in the region, President Erdoğan underscored that immediate action is needed to prevent a catastrophe that could engulf the entire region in flames. President Erdoğan’s congratulatory message on Azerbaijan’s National Salvation Day

In a post shared on his social media account, President Recep Tayyip Erdoğan marked Azerbaijan's June 15 National Salvation Day. In his message, President Erdoğan said: "I congratulate the June 15 National Salvation Day of Azerbaijan, our family, our hearth and the apple of our eye, with my most heartfelt feelings and convey my greetings and affection to all my Azerbaijani brothers and sisters."
